Introduced , by Rep. Michael D. Unes

 

SYNOPSIS AS INTRODUCED:
 
25 ILCS 5/3.3 new

    Amends the General Assembly Organization Act. Provides that if a bill is passed unanimously by one legislative chamber, then the other legislative chamber shall conduct a public hearing on the bill and it shall receive a record vote within 3 session days.

1    AN ACT concerning State government.
 
2    Be it enacted by the People of the State of Illinois,
3represented in the General Assembly:
 
4    Section 5. The General Assembly Organization Act is amended
5by adding Section 3.3 as follows:
 
6    (25 ILCS 5/3.3 new)
7    Sec. 3.3. Required consideration of unanimously passed
8bills.
9    (a) If a bill passes the House of Representatives
10unanimously, then the Senate shall conduct a public hearing on
11the bill and it shall receive a record vote within 3 Senate
12session days after the day the bill is unanimously passed by
13the House of Representatives.
14    (b) If a bill passes the Senate unanimously, then the House
15of Representatives shall conduct a public hearing on the bill
16and it shall receive a record vote within 3 House session days
17after the day the bill is unanimously passed by the Senate.
